What are the popular events and traditions at New College of Florida?

New College of Florida hosts a variety of engaging events that foster community spirit among students. The Late Night Breakfast is a well-attended tradition that offers students a chance to enjoy food and socialize during late hours, providing a break from academic pressures. The Dance Collective Performances showcase the talents of students interested in dance, serving as an artistic outlet and a cultural highlight on campus. Additionally, the Pumpkin Patch event brings a festive atmosphere each year, allowing students to participate in seasonal activities that strengthen campus camaraderie.

What are the student housing and dining options at New College of Florida?

New College of Florida offers college-owned housing that accommodates a majority of its student body, with approximately 74% of students living on campus. Housing options are coeducational, providing a shared living environment for all genders. Students who are freshmen are permitted to have parking privileges on campus, facilitating easier access to their residences and campus facilities.
